Unity Announces Luminary Walk to raise funds for Grief and Education Center
UNITY HOSPICE

GREEN BAY – On Friday, May 12, 2023, Unity, Northeast Wisconsin’s nonprofit leader in hospice care, supportive care, nonmedical home care and grief support, will host its second annual Luminary Walk to raise funds for Unity Grief and Education Center, the region’s only freestanding Center designed to support individuals and families of all ages who have experienced a death.

The Luminary Walk will take place at Heritage Hill State Historical Park, 2640 S. Webster Avenue, Green Bay, WI. Participants will have the opportunity to walk in honor of a loved one, in support of someone grieving or to show support for those in our communities who are facing a loss. The Luminary Walk is a community event open to all...

Apply for the AARP Small Dollar, Big Impact Grant by March 21
AARP   

Applications are accepted from across Wisconsin for “Small Dollar, Big Impact” grants, which will be awarded to new projects that are designed to improve a community and make it a better place for everyone to live, work, and play as they age. 

Projects must use the AARP Livable Communities Resource library in their development. Within the resource library you will find publications and tool kits that provide ideas on placemaking, public space improvements, or simple ways to address walkability, to name a few. AARP Wisconsin may award a grant of up to $1,000 to at least one eligible applicant. 

The grant amount could be a portion of or the total cost for the project. All projects must be completed within 60 days from winner announcement. if your project includes public engagement, please ensure that the activities follow all local/state guidelines.....

KI changing lives, one chair at a time, with Door County Candle Company donation
WLUK

STURGEON BAY -- A furniture company is giving those tirelessly fundraising for Ukraine, a place to rest.

On Friday, KI delivered 12 specially designed chairs to Door County Candle Company in Sturgeon Bay.

Since February of last year, Door County Candle Company has been making and selling special-edition candles, raising more than $800,000 for Ukrainians during the Russian invasion. This effort has sparked to help other causes, including the victims of Hurricane Ian and a massive earthquake that struck Turkey and Syria last month...

From Cuba to Green Bay: Artist's work depicts 'complex and subtle realities' of life in his home country
GREEN BAY PRESS GAZETTE 

GREEN BAY -- When Eduin Fraga was experiencing economic hardship in Cuba, he turned to art and grew to be an accomplished artist.

“I started painting at 28 years old because I saw that my brother, who is also an artist, and his friends were able to make money selling art in the market. In Cuba, work is very difficult so when you are able to sell to tourists, it is an easier way to make money,” Fraga said.

Now living in Green Bay with trips home to Cuba to visit family, Fraga was a diligent learner. He watched his brother and the other artists and studied their techniques using shapes and light. But his art took a unique direction during an especially hard economic time in Cuba when it was difficult to find canvas for painting...

Local moms combat child care crisis in rural Outagamie County by starting new center
APPLETON POST-CRESCENT

During their regular walks through their Hortonville neighborhood, working mothers Virginia Maus and Tiffany Simon discuss a plethora of topics. Over the past couple of months, a reoccurring theme occurred: the hardships they, and other local families, face due to the area's lack of regulated child care.

So when Kuddly Kids Child Care, one of the few licensed child care options in the Dale-Hortonville area and the center Simon's three children were attending, announced last fall that it was closing, the duo knew they had to take action. Even though neither had previous experience working in child care, they bought the building and started a licensed center of their own: Joyful Beginnings Academy....

Celebrating a 150-year legacy: Kohler Co., initially named Kohler & Silberzahn, started out making plows, other farm equipment
THE BUSINESS NEWS

KOHLER – This year marks the 150-year anniversary of Kohler Co., one of America’s oldest and largest privately held companies.

Founded in 1873 and headquartered in Kohler, a village in Sheboygan County west of Lake Michigan with just more than 2,000 residents, Kohler Co. is world-renowned for its reputation as a global leader.

Given the challenges businesses face today, including an ongoing global pandemic and economic and political challenges, Chair and CEO David Kohler said the company’s sesquicentennial is cause for celebration....

Fond du Lac's Hotel Retlaw celebrates 100 years after unexpected closure, reopening
WLUK

FOND DU LAC -- From 1923 through 2023, the Hotel Retlaw has remained an integral part of the Fond du Lac community.

"It was the hub of the city at one time," lifelong Fond du Lac Resident Bill Weinshrott said. Weinshrott has memories at the hotel dating back to the 1940s.

"My father was a ice delivery man -- delivered ice," Weinshrott said. "When I was in the sixth grade, when it was summer vacation, my dad says, 'Well, now, you're off, so you'll help me deliver ice'. So, we used to come here about three times a day."

More than 70 years later, Weinshrott was there to see the hotel reach its 100th anniversary...
